Possible Side Effects Of Glucosamine Chondroitin. Supplements can help treat osteoarthritis and other inflammatory conditions. Glucosamine can cause some mild side effects including bloating, nausea, diarrhea, and constipation. Common side effects are itching and mild digestive problems such as heartburn, diarrhea, vomiting, and nausea.
